#3bdd9e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#3bdd9e is composed of 23.1% red, 86.7% green and 62%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 73.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 28.5% yellow and 13.3% black. It has a hue angle of 156.7 degrees, a saturation of 70.4% and a lightness of 54.9%. #3bdd9e color hex could be obtained by blending #76ffff with #00bb3d. Closest websafe color is: #33cc99.

#3bdd9e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#3bdd9e has RGB values of R:59, G:221, B:158 and CMYK values of C:0.73, M:0, Y:0.29, K:0.13. Its decimal value is 3923358.

Shades and Tints of #3bdd9e
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010503 is the darkest color, while #f3fdf9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#3bdd9e
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8b8d8c is the less saturated color, while #20f8a4 is the most saturated one.
